Highlights
2008
Cast as the female lead in the dark comedy "Meet Bill" alongside Aaron Eckhart
2008
Portrayed First Lady Laura Bush in Oliver Stone's biopic "W." on the life of President George W. Bush
2008
Co-starred with Seth Rogen as the eponymous female lead in the Kevin Smith comedy, "Zack and Miri Make a Porno"
2007
Reprised role of Betty Brant for "Spider-Man 3"
2007
Co-starred with Vince Vaughn and Paul Giamatti in the comedy "Fred Claus"
2006
Cast as Mark Wahlberg's love interest in "Invincible"; based on the true story of Eagles football player Vince Papale
2006 - 2007
Appeared in the season five finale of the NBC sitcom "Scrubs" as the love interest to J.D. (Zach Braff); had a recurring role in season six
2005
Cast opposite Steve Carrell in the Judd Apatow comedy "The 40-Year Old Virgin"
2004
Again portrayed Betty Brant in "Spider-Man 2"
2003
Breakout role as Jeff Bridges' wife in the Gary Ross directed "Seabiscuit"
2002
Cast as Betty Brant in the blockbuster hit "Spider-Man"
2002
Appeared in Steven Spielberg's "Catch Me If Your Can" opposite Leonardo DiCaprio
2001
Appeared in the cult comedy, "Wet Hot American Summer"
2000
Cast in a small role in John Singleton's "Shaft"
1999
TV debut, an episode of the NBC drama "Third Watch"
1998
First film role, the independent drama "Surrender Dorothy" (credited as Elizabeth Casey)
